A "giveaway" is not a program for people to test products, it is a contest that is basically a free to enter lottery where people exchange not their money for entry - but their social media feeds/ friends/ personal information/ email inbox.

Understand that everyone entering these things is giving these companies something of value, and if they win, they deserve to keep the value of the item if they so desire. You may give out hundreds of dollars of advertising and your personal information to these companies before you win anything.

A giveaway is for marketing purposes only - to get people to look at their product or watch a video or sign up on a website. That is the value. There is no follow-up. You are not signing up for a research trial. They don't care if you chuck the product you won into the sea after you get it.
